Microsoft Bangladesh announces the selectees of 'Expert Educators and Mentor Schools Program'

Recently Microsoft Bangladesh declared that an educator and a school in Bangladesh have been selected to take part in its Expert Educator and Mentor Schools programs. Members of both programs will become part of an exclusive one-year initiative that recognizes pioneer educators and school leaders using technology to transform education. Every year, the Expert Educator program selects 250 educators to be part of an exclusive global community of educational leaders who use technology to positively impact learning and student outcomes.. The selected educator and the school will be receiving a wide range of benefits and exposure i.e. an invitation to attend the Microsoft in Education Global Forum-Barcelona taking place in March 2014, free Surface devices for their schools, insider access to Microsoft strategy and technologies, professional and career development opportunities and certifications including peer coaching. This year, Hafez Allama Mohammad Mohiul Hoque and his institute 'Naziria Naymia Mahmudia Madrasha' has been selected to participate in this program.
